I think I will attempt multiple toppings rather than quadline on the Chocolate Haze. There will be some tying down as well. I would like to veg both these plants until mid-December. There will be a learning curve as I have never grown a photoperiod before nor tried to contain growth for that long. Should be fun.

That is my main gripe with autoflowers, there not really vegging until day 15 or so and they're flowering by day 30, usually, so you only have a two week window for playing with it. Sometimes it will go longer like the Lambs Breath which went 7 weeks before flowering, but it is unpredictable and hard to plan out.

I was trying to figure out a way to keep the WW seedling going in the veg tent without burning it under the blurple. Thinking a screen might help we tested the lux under a sieve colander kitchen thing. This just might work, the seedling looked much better today. Before the screen it looked like it was trying to hide from the sun.
Veg Tent 19-11-16-2.JPG

Sensor is at the top of photo but you can see the reading is 13,800 lux.

Veg Tent 19-11-16-1.JPG

and here it is under the screen reading 4,900 lux
